Your period is determined by what's going on in your uterus, namely by your ovulation---not by anything you're doing outside. No ovulation, no period.

You sound very young, so it's not a cause for alarm if your period is late occasionally. If you miss more than a few, you should see a doctor.

the 'cherry' is the hymen, which is a membrane of tissue that covers the opening of the vagina (on the inside of your body). It could completely cover the vagina, or only cover it a little (and some women don't have much of one, everyone's different).

The membrane rarely "pops" - it's very thin, but it stretches when something is inserted into the vagina. So it could have torn slightly, or you could have just accidentally scratched yourself somewhere on the vaginal wall - both will bleed a little. But I don't think you'd rupture it completely. Anything done to your hymen or vaginal wall won't affect your period - that's determined by the hormones in your body.

Give yourself a few days to heal any potential scratches and try to watch out for it in the future (sharp fingernails can sometimes be a hazard). But unless you're being very rough I don't think major hymen damage is a worry - even internal examinations from doctors can happen without the hymen being damaged, they're pretty tough.
